Airmadidi is the capital of the North Minahasa Regency, North Sulawesi, Indonesia. The area's population is estimated at around 21,000. Airmadidi is home to Universitas Advent (Advent University) and Universitas Klabat (Klabat University). There is also a well known Airmadidi market.

Airmadidi means boiling water and the area is home to mineral springs.[1] There are also waruga sarcophagi in the area.[1]
